Small Checks Today Can Prevent Big Bills Tomorrow

A proper inspection doesn’t just help identify current issues; it can highlight areas that are likely to cause trouble later. Loose shingles, clogged gutters, or worn flashing might seem minor now, but justify unchecked, they can lead to water damage, insulation failure, and even structural issues.

By using a checklist that covers every part of your roof—from ridge caps to drainage—you stay ahead of problems. That means fewer surprise repairs, and less need for emergency fixes that often come with higher price tags.

What Should Your Checklist Include?

A reliable roof inspection checklist should cover more than just a glance from the ground. Here are a few important things it should include:

  • Missing or cracked shingles
  • Condition of the flashing around chimneys and vents
  • Signs of moss, mold, or rot
  • Cleanliness of gutters and drainage paths
  • Interior signs like water stains or soft spots on ceilings

Including both exterior and interior checks ensures a full picture of your roof’s condition.
